After review of the menus, I really am disappointed in the Halo menu. We love Mexican food, but this is not what we consider a Specialty Restaurant menu. It is more like Taco Bell. 

As for Tepenyacky they want to charge you $20 more per person for scallops & lobster? How much lobster would you get to warrant the extra $20.

 

MSC Specialty Restaurants are totally overpriced. 

We have an Unlimited Dining Pkg on Oasis OTS for 7 nights in any Specialty Restaurant, as many times as, we want to return to the same SR. Not like MSC dictating what SRs you may attend. 

That includes lunches in any SR on Sea Days. You also may choose anything from the entire menu.  That cost me $217 for the 7 nights, plus Sea day lunches. That included the tips, too.

Why is MSC so expensive? NCL and Celebrity have better prices, too.
